The main difference to LiPo and LiIon batteries is the lower voltage range of 3.3 volts to a maximum of 3.6 volts per cell. LiFe batteries are much less sensitive to under- and overvoltage. They are characterized by a very constant and flat discharge curve as well as a very high cycle stability.

Internal chip for battery telemetry
The passive MTAG chip stores battery data such as type, cell count, capacity, C-rate or battery ID. If required*, these values can be read out with an external NFC sensor such as the HACKER or JETI MTAG and transferred to the transmitter telemetry.
Likewise, the built-in MTAG chip offers the possibility to count and store the charging cycles manually or automatically. When using several identical batteries in serial or parallel operation, this enables more effective active battery management.
*Note: It is up to the user whether to use the MTAG function or not. The TopFuel battery can be used without MTAG like any ordinary battery.
